We're seeking a future member for the role of Financial and Regulatory Reporting Specialist to join our CONTROLLERS - External Reporting team. This role is in Pune, MH- Hybrid.
In this role, you'll make an impact in the following ways:
- Prepare and review financial and regulatory reports in compliance with industry standards and regulations.
- Analyse financial data to ensure accuracy and completeness.
- Provide commentary for Balance Sheet and Income Statement.
- Observations and recommendations on Balance Sheet and P&L trends
- Develop and maintain a control mindset, ensuring all processes are efficient and effective.
- Stay updated with new technologies and learn new skills to enhance reporting processes.
- Communicate effectively with team members and stakeholders, both in writing and verbally.
- Collaborate with team members to achieve common goals and objectives.
- Develop knowledge in Basel reporting and non-Basel reporting.
- Understand financial products and financial statements to provide insightful analysis.
- Work confidently and proactively on unstructured assignments.
- Qualified Chartered Accountant (CA) or ICMA.
- 5 to 7 years of experience in the banking industry, with a focus on financial and regulatory reporting.
- Strong analytical skills and attention to detail.
- Control mindset and readiness to learn new things.
- Tech-savvy with the ability to adapt to new technologies.
- Excellent written and communication skills.
- Team player with the ability to collaborate effectively.
- Keen interest in developing knowledge in Basel and non-Basel reporting.
- Understanding of financial products and financial statements is an added advantage.
- Confident, proactive, and able to work on unstructured assignments.
- Work experience in Legal Entity Reporting & Professional CA Firms is preferred.
